Ingredients
– For the Dough:
– 4 cups all-purpose flour
– 1/4 cup granulated sugar
– 1 packet (2 1/4 teaspoons) instant yeast
– 1/2 teaspoon salt
– 1 cup milk, warmed
– 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
– 2 large eggs
– For the Custard Filling:
– 2 cups milk
– 4 large egg yolks
– 1/2 cup granulated sugar
– 1/4 cup cornstarch
– 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
– For the Raspberry Filling:
– 1 1/2 cups fresh raspberries (or frozen, thawed)
– 1/4 cup granulated sugar
– 1 tablespoon lemon juice
– For Garnish (optional):
– Powdered sugar
– Fresh mint leaves
Step-by-Step Instructions
Follow these steps carefully to create the perfect Raspberry Custard Buns:
1. Prepare the Dough: In a large bowl, combine flour, sugar, yeast, and salt.
2. Combine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the warmed milk, melted butter, and eggs.
3. Mix Together: Gradually add the wet mixture to the dry ingredients, stirring until a soft dough forms.
4. Knead the Dough: Transfer the dough to a floured surface and knead for about 5-7 minutes until smooth and elastic.
5. Let it Rise: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over with a damp cloth, and let it rise in a warm environment for about 1 hour or until doubled in size.
6. Prepare the Custard: In a saucepan, combine milk, egg yolks, sugar, and cornstarch.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until thickened. Stir in vanilla extract and set aside to cool.
7. Prepare the Raspberry Filling: In another bowl, mash the raspberries with sugar and lemon juice until combined. Set aside.
8. Assemble the Buns: Once the dough has risen, punch it down and roll it out into a rectangle about 1/2 inch thick. Cut into squares or circles.
9. Fill the Buns: Place a spoonful of custard in the center of each piece, followed by a small spoonful of the raspberry mixture.
10. Seal the Buns: Fold the corners over the filling, pinch to seal, and shape into a bun. Place seam-side down on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
11. Second Rise: Cover the buns with a cloth and let them rise for about 30 minutes.
12.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
13. Bake the Buns: Bake the buns in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until golden brown.
14. Cool: Remove from the oven and let the buns cool on a wire rack for about 15 minutes.
15. Garnish: Optionally, dust with powdered sugar and garnish with fresh mint before serving.

Additional Tips
– Use Fresh Raspberries: Opt for fresh raspberries for the best flavor and texture. If using frozen, ensure they are fully thawed, and drain any excess liquid.
– Cool the Buns Completely: Allow the buns to cool completely before serving. This helps the flavors to meld and enhances the overall taste.
– Experiment with Flavors: Try adding different extracts, like almond or lemon, to the custard for a unique twist on the classic flavor.
– Ensure Proper Sealing: Make sure to pinch the buns tightly to prevent any filling from leaking out during baking.

Freezing and Storage
– Storage: Keep the Raspberry Custard Buns in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days. For longer storage, refrigerate them.
– Freezing: You can freeze the buns for up to three months. Wrap them individually in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ag. Thaw in the refrigerator before enjoying.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use other types of fruit besides raspberries?
Yes, other fruits like blackberries, strawberries, or blueberries work wonderfully as substitutes.
How do I prevent the buns from deflating after baking?
Ensure that you do not over-knead the dough, as that may cause the buns to become dense.
Can I prepare the dough in advance?
Absolutely! You can prepare the dough the night before and place it in the refrigerator to rise slowly for better flavor.
What if I don’t have instant yeast?
You can substitute it with active dry yeast, but be sure to activate it in warm water or milk with a bit of sugar before mixing it into the dry ingredients.
